Municipal sludge lightweight porous ceramsite and preparation method thereof
The invention relates to a ceramic material, and provides a municipal sludge lightweight porous ceramsite and a preparation method thereof. The municipal sludge lightweight porous ceramsite comprises the following raw materials in parts by weight: 30-40 parts of municipal sludge, 20-40 parts of shale, 10-15 parts of coal gangue, 5-10 parts of granular activated carbon, 3-8 parts of secondary aluminum ash, 2-5 parts of a binder and 10-20 parts of water. The preparation method of the municipal sludge lightweight porous ceramsite comprises the following steps: drying and crushing municipal sludge; shale and coal gangue are subjected to crushing treatment; mixing the municipal sludge, shale and coal gangue with granular activated carbon, secondary aluminum ash, a binder and water, and granulating to obtain a spherical ceramsite raw material; and sintering the spherical ceramsite raw material at high temperature to obtain the municipal sludge lightweight porous ceramsite. The municipal sludge lightweight porous ceramsite has a lightweight porous structure and also has relatively high compressive strength. In the preparation method of the municipal sludge lightweight porous ceramsite, the municipal sludge utilization rate is high, and the ceramsite has the advantages of greenness and low carbon.
